Summary
NetChoice filed suit against California Attorney General Robert Bonta on grounds that the California Age-Appropriate Design Code Act (AB-2273) violates the First and Fourth Amendments, the Dormant Commerce Clause, and the Due Process Clause and is too vague.
Updates
September 18, 2023. US District Court for the Northern District of California Judge Beth L. Freeman granted a preliminary injunction in favor of NetChoice on the grounds that the Act violates the First Amendment.
October 18, 2023. Attorney General Bonta filed a notice of appeal to overturn the preliminary injunction.
December 13, 2023. Attorney General Bonta filed an opening brief in the Ninth Circuit Court of Appeals challenging the district court's decision.
